Output 0881c8156105a2ac79333ca3d809175be081cf94766eb3813ce2179347a07815: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757441dd019f50ae7a8b4563493bd894a95663ef OP_EQUAL
address
3CQ4FghPgoyEdtudx1JFzMp3mv6BRJrpj1
transaction
0881c8156105a2ac79333ca3d809175be081cf94766eb3813ce2179347a07815
confirmations
271961
spent
true